Pros & Cons

Honest take: letRetro vs Echometer

letRetroStrengths
  • AI-powered summaries and insights make retrospectives smarter and faster
  • Strong integration and workflow direction through Slack, Jira, GitHub, GitLab, Linear, Notion, and API-first extensibility
  • Unlimited members on paid plans, with pricing designed around teams rather than per-user complexity
  • Modern, AI-first experience designed for speed
letRetroLimitations
  • The product is more focused on retrospectives and AI workflow than on broader team-health or 1:1 management
  • Compared with older, more established tools, the brand may still need more trust-building content, case studies, and social proof
  • Some advanced capabilities, like self-hosting, are still coming soon
EchometerStrengths
  • Strong team health checks, team radar tracking, and longitudinal improvement monitoring
  • Large library of retrospective templates, icebreakers, and structured facilitation support
  • Good for teams that want a structured, psychology-backed retro process
EchometerLimitations
  • More structured and template-heavy, which can feel heavier than a modern AI-first workflow
  • Health checks and 1:1 tools can make the product feel broader, but not always as focused on fast retro execution
  • Integrations appear more limited in public reviews, with Jira and calendar sync more visible than Slack, GitHub, Linear, or Confluence

01Is Echometer more expensive than letRetro?+

Echometer starts at €29/team/mo, while letRetro Pro is $15/mo flat per team. For teams on a budget, letRetro's flat pricing is significantly cheaper while covering unlimited members.

02Does Echometer have AI features?+

Echometer offers AI summaries and AI action items, but lacks team insights, AI agent delegation, and triage intelligence. Its trend & root-cause detection and retro-to-ticket pipeline are only partially covered.

03Which is better for fast retro execution?+

letRetro is designed for a fast, AI-first workflow with deep integrations into Slack, Jira, GitHub, GitLab, Linear, and Notion. Echometer's template-heavy, health-check-focused approach is stronger for structured processes than for speed.
